Alcohol-free drinks are a great way to help you do that and if you don’t want to feel like you’re missing out, a non alcoholic drink could be the way to go.If you have made the decision not to drink alcohol there is no reason anyone should make you feel bad about it, be unapologetic for your own wellbeing. If you are worried what people might say about the fact that you aren’t drinking, alcohol free wine, beer or spirits will help you fit in (they look and taste like alcoholic drinks).You don’t have to be sober to buy from us, sometimes you may want to manage your alcohol consumption, or you just like to drink in moderation – there is no judgement from us. When you pick up an alcohol free drink you are choosing a healthier option, it is appropriate for work functions (no more embarrassing Christmas party stories), if you struggle with dietary requirements there are plenty of non alcoholic alternatives for you, it is a tastier and fresher option to classics like tea, coffee or soft drink, you won’t put on weight from drinking and best of all it taste likes alcohol but isn’t! You get all the good stuff with none of the bad that so often accompanies alcohol. Non alcoholic drinks are becoming more and more popular, people are starting to realise the health benefits and stray away from the alcoholic beverages.
